HERO OF THE WEEK

Jackie Joyner-KerseeJacqueline "Jackie" Joyner-Kersee (born

March 3, 1962) is a retired American athlete, ranked among the all-time greatest athletes in the women's heptathlon as well as in the

women's long jump. She won three gold, one silver, and two bronze Olympic medals, in those two events at four different Olympic

Games. Sports Illustrated for Women magazine voted Joyner-Kersee the

Greatest Female Athlete of the 20th century, just ahead of Babe Didrikson Zaharias.
